Output f43687e2c96c6b8cd30e13941103f2643e13fbbf34199f13a30ac03dd9d0055a:1

value
6079686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ddce609e39f89bfd5217a9bba88a4c57eadc94eb OP_EQUAL
address
3MupVHuvYHFNcmH19ywwju3ZUzuBjVmYJb
transaction
f43687e2c96c6b8cd30e13941103f2643e13fbbf34199f13a30ac03dd9d0055a
spent
true